Unlocking the Potential of AI with DeepBrain Chain: A Revolutionary Approach to Computational Resources
The convergence of artificial intelligence and blockchain technology promises a world where computational costs reduce dramatically. At the forefront of this transformation is DeepBrain Chain, a pioneering platform dedicated to providing resources necessary for AI development. Founded in May 2017, it represents a significant leap toward an efficient and scalable AI ecosystem.
DeepBrain Chain stands out by aggregating computing resources from contributors worldwide. This decentralized approach not only alleviates the financial burden associated with training AI models but also ensures that computational power remains accessible to a broader spectrum of developers and companies. By enabling participants to contribute their unused processing capabilities, we witness a recalibration in resource allocation within the tech landscape.
One of the core innovations offered by DeepBrain Chain lies in its unique rewards system for miners. Unlike traditional mining operations that often waste energy on unproductive tasks, miners on this platform are compensated for their contributions toward AI computing needs. They receive payments in DBC (DeepBrain Coin) as well as Neo Gas, which reinforces the economic ecosystem underpinning this venture.

In terms of infrastructure, the DBC network harnesses three pivotal components: high-performance computing nodes, a mainnet, and GPU computing capabilities. This trifecta facilitates industries ranging from cloud gaming to sophisticated blockchain computations while providing unparalleled support for AI training and inference tasks.
The DBC token serves as the lifeblood of this nascent economy, designed meticulously to maximize participation across various entities — be it developers, educational institutions, or financial providers — creating an inclusive ecosystem that thrives on collaboration rather than competition. With a capped total supply of 10 billion tokens and a progressive mining schedule that fosters sustainable engagement over time, DBC is poised for longevity.
The roadmap has been ambitious yet methodical since inception: launching exchanges within hours during token sales, establishing research labs in Silicon Valley focused on P2P networks for training purposes, and releasing high-performance networks aimed at solving real-world challenges have all been pivotal milestones.
